Impressions about the French Quarter:
lovely old architecture
narrow streets
rich history documented with plaques
lots of visiting tourist
smelly streets in some areas
the quarter is a real living and working neighborhood surrounded by a newer city
friendly respectful locals
hot and humid - drink water and a sports drink too
walk, wear comfortable footwear
booze starts serving at 11am
drivers can be crazy on these narrow streets

I really like it here. We will come back and visit this area again.
